Subject: Re: [PATCH 2/2] timer: imx-tpm: add imx tpm timer support

On Sat, May 13, 2017 at 9:29 AM, Dong Aisheng <aisheng.dong@....com> wrote:

> diff --git a/drivers/clocksource/Kconfig b/drivers/clocksource/Kconfig
> index 3356ab8..03dfd6a 100644
> --- a/drivers/clocksource/Kconfig
> +++ b/drivers/clocksource/Kconfig
> @@ -590,6 +590,11 @@ config CLKSRC_IMX_GPT
>         depends on ARM && CLKDEV_LOOKUP
>         select CLKSRC_MMIO
>
> +config CLKSRC_IMX_TPM
> +       bool "Clocksource using i.MX TPM" if COMPILE_TEST
> +       depends on ARM && CLKDEV_LOOKUP && GENERIC_CLOCKEVENTS
> +       select CLKSRC_MMIO
> +

This needs a help text


> +static inline void tpm_timer_disable(void)
> +{
> +       unsigned int val;
> +
> +       /* channel disable */
> +       val = __raw_readl(timer_base + TPM_C0SC);
> +       val &= ~(TPM_C0SC_MODE_MASK | TPM_C0SC_CHIE);
> +       __raw_writel(val, timer_base + TPM_C0SC);
> +}

__raw_readl/__raw_writel is broken on big-endian kernels, please
use readl/writel instead.

        Arnd
